#27214b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#27214b is composed of 15.3% red, 12.9%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48% cyan, 56% magenta, 0%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 248.6 degrees, a saturation of 38.9% and a lightness of 21.2%. #27214b color hex could be obtained by blending #4e4296 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#27214b color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#27214b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#27214b has RGB values of R:39, G:33, B:75 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 2564427.
